When you look at dental bills, the final amount depends on several variables. The biggest factors are the complexity of the procedure and the materials used, such as whether a crown is porcelain or gold. If you have insurance, that impacts your out-of-pocket share, while those paying cash might see different rates based on the office's overhead. A dentist is a highly trained professional focused on oral health. They diagnose, treat, and prevent conditions affecting your teeth, gums, and mouth. Dentists perform everything from routine cleanings to complex restorative procedures. Their primary aim is to help you maintain a healthy and functional smile.
Wisdom teeth are generally considered the most challenging to extract. Their location at the back of the mouth, along with potential impaction or unusual root formations, can complicate the procedure. The patient's bone density and the tooth's specific orientation also contribute to the difficulty. A dentist will assess these factors.
